I made lots of houses using The Artistic Stamper house stamp sets, then paper pieced them and arranged on my pages. Added some peel off numbers coloured with gold alcohol ink to the doors.
Stamped the Stampotique children stamp by Janet Klein onto book page, cut out into individuals and popped onto my pages as they're playing out.
Next my Hot Air Balloon embellishment.I'd gotten some metal tape and had a play. Using a small balloon from the Tando Creative Hot Air Balloons grab bag, I stuck a chipboard number 7 then covered it in layers of torn metal tape, burnishing them well using plastic paper shapers. I did experiment with paint and ink, but didn't like it so took it off and just used alcohol inks in mushroom and bronze. Glued to my page and again job done. I really enjoyed playing putting this together, paper, stamps paint, chipboard and stencils, my favourite things.
